How To Convert Characters to Times in Oracle?
Submitted by: AdministratorYou can convert dates to characters using the TO_CHAR() function as shown in the following examples:
SELECT TO_CHAR(TO_DATE('04:49:49', 'HH:MI:SS'),
'D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S') FROM DUAL;
-- Default date is the first day of the current month
01-MAY-2006 04:49:49
SELECT TO_CHAR(TO_TIMESTAMP('16:52:57.847000000',
'HH24:MI:SS.FF9'), 'D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S.FF9')
FROM DUAL;
01-MAY-2006 16:52:57.847000000
SELECT TO_CHAR(TO_DATE('69520', 'SSSSS'),
'D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S') FROM DUAL;
01-MAY-2006 19:18:40
